Fort Wayne Makes Big Neighborhood Investments

red and white striped pole

FORT WAYNE, Ind. (WOWO) – The City of Fort Wayne is about to spend almost $50-million on streets, sidewalks, alleys, bridges, and other various infrastructure projects.

Mayor Karl Bandemer made that announcement that has a partial intent of putting more money back into neighborhoods as well, by providing funding for alleys and trails, as well.
